Partager via


ReplicationDatabase.Script Method

Returns a Transact-SQL script to enable or disable replication publishing and subscriptions on the database based on the properties of ReplicationDatabase.

Espace de noms: Microsoft.SqlServer.Replication
Assembly: Microsoft.SqlServer.Rmo (in microsoft.sqlserver.rmo.dll)

Syntaxe

'Déclaration
Public Function Script ( _
    scriptOption As ScriptOptions _
) As String
public string Script (
    ScriptOptions scriptOption
)
public:
String^ Script (
    ScriptOptions scriptOption
)
public String Script (
    ScriptOptions scriptOption
)
public function Script (
    scriptOption : ScriptOptions
) : String

Paramètres

  • scriptOption
    A ScriptOptions object value that specifies the replication options to script.

Valeur de retour

A String value that contains the Transact-SQL script.

Notes

The scriptOption parameter specifies what is to be included in the script. For example:

  • Use Creation to get the creation script.

  • Use Deletion to get the deletion script.

  • Use IncludePublications to include creation scripts for all publications that belong to the database.

  • Use IncludePullSubscriptions to include creation scripts for all pull subscriptions that belong to the database.

You must specify at least one of the following: Creation or Deletion.

This namespace, class, or member is supported only in version 2.0 of the .NET Framework.

Sécurité des threads

Any public static (Shared in Microsoft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

Plateformes

Plateformes de développement

Pour obtenir la liste des plateformes prises en charge, consultez Configuration matérielle et logicielle requise pour l'installation de SQL Server 2005.

Plateformes cibles

Pour obtenir la liste des plateformes prises en charge, consultez Configuration matérielle et logicielle requise pour l'installation de SQL Server 2005.

Voir aussi

Référence

ReplicationDatabase Class
ReplicationDatabase Members
Microsoft.SqlServer.Replication Namespace